गहरी शिक्षा की गणितीय नींवआजकल डीप लर्निंग हर जगह है, चाहे वो इमेज रिकग्निशन हो या भाषा अनुवाद, सब में इसका इस्तेमाल हो रहा है। लेकिन क्या आप जानते हैं कि इसके पीछे की असली ताकत गणित है?
हाँ, आपने सही सुना! कैलकुलस, लीनियर अलजेब्रा और प्रायिकता जैसे गणितीय अवधारणाएं ही डीप लर्निंग को इतना शक्तिशाली बनाती हैं। मेरा मानना है कि अगर आप डीप लर्निंग को सही से समझना चाहते हैं, तो आपको गणित की बुनियादी बातों को जानना बहुत जरूरी है।डीप लर्निंग के एल्गोरिदम जटिल गणितीय समीकरणों पर आधारित होते हैं, जो डेटा से सीखते हैं और भविष्यवाणियां करते हैं। यह गणित ही है जो मशीनों को इंसानों की तरह सोचने और सीखने की क्षमता देता है। मैंने जब पहली बार इन समीकरणों को देखा, तो थोड़ा डर लगा था, लेकिन धीरे-धीरे समझ आने लगा कि ये सब आपस में कैसे जुड़े हुए हैं।आजकल, GPT जैसे मॉडल बहुत चर्चा में हैं, और ये सब भी गणितीय नींव पर ही टिके हुए हैं। भविष्य में, डीप लर्निंग और गणित का यह संयोजन और भी अद्भुत चीजें कर सकता है।चलिए, इस बारे में और ज़्यादा गहराई से जानते हैं।आगे लेख में, हम विस्तार से जानेंगे!
आजकल डीप लर्निंग हर जगह है, चाहे वो इमेज रिकग्निशन हो या भाषा अनुवाद, सब में इसका इस्तेमाल हो रहा है। लेकिन क्या आप जानते हैं कि इसके पीछे की असली ताकत गणित है?
हाँ, आपने सही सुना! कैलकुलस, लीनियर अलजेब्रा और प्रायिकता जैसे गणितीय अवधारणाएं ही डीप लर्निंग को इतना शक्तिशाली बनाती हैं। मेरा मानना है कि अगर आप डीप लर्निंग को सही से समझना चाहते हैं, तो आपको गणित की बुनियादी बातों को जानना बहुत जरूरी है।डीप लर्निंग के एल्गोरिदम जटिल गणितीय समीकरणों पर आधारित होते हैं, जो डेटा से सीखते हैं और भविष्यवाणियां करते हैं। यह गणित ही है जो मशीनों को इंसानों की तरह सोचने और सीखने की क्षमता देता है। मैंने जब पहली बार इन समीकरणों को देखा, तो थोड़ा डर लगा था, लेकिन धीरे-धीरे समझ आने लगा कि ये सब आपस में कैसे जुड़े हुए हैं।आजकल, GPT जैसे मॉडल बहुत चर्चा में हैं, और ये सब भी गणितीय नींव पर ही टिके हुए हैं। भविष्य में, डीप लर्निंग और गणित का यह संयोजन और भी अद्भुत चीजें कर सकता है।चलिए, इस बारे में और ज़्यादा गहराई से जानते हैं।
डीप लर्निंग में लीनियर अलजेब्रा का महत्व

डीप लर्निंग में लीनियर अलजेब्रा एक बुनियादी उपकरण है। यह डेटा को मैट्रिक्स और वेक्टर के रूप में प्रस्तुत करने में मदद करता है, जिससे एल्गोरिदम डेटा को कुशलतापूर्वक प्रोसेस कर सकते हैं। मेरे अनुभव में, लीनियर अलजेब्रा की समझ के बिना, आप डीप लर्निंग एल्गोरिदम के अंदरूनी कामकाज को पूरी तरह से नहीं समझ सकते।
मैट्रिक्स और वेक्टर संचालन
लीनियर अलजेब्रा में, मैट्रिक्स और वेक्टर का उपयोग डेटा को संग्रहीत और हेरफेर करने के लिए किया जाता है। मैट्रिक्स गुणन, ट्रांसपोज़ और व्युत्क्रम जैसे संचालन डीप लर्निंग मॉडल के प्रशिक्षण में महत्वपूर्ण भूमिका निभाते हैं। मैंने देखा है कि जब मैं मैट्रिक्स गुणन को अनुकूलित करता हूं, तो मेरे मॉडल की गति काफी बढ़ जाती है।
आइगेन वैल्यू और आइगेन वेक्टर
आइगेन वैल्यू और आइगेन वेक्टर का उपयोग डेटा की संरचना को समझने और उसे कम करने के लिए किया जाता है। प्रिंसिपल कंपोनेंट एनालिसिस (PCA) जैसी तकनीकें आइगेन वैल्यू और आइगेन वेक्टर पर आधारित होती हैं, और इनका उपयोग डेटा के आयाम को कम करने और मॉडल को सरल बनाने के लिए किया जाता है।
सिंगुलर वैल्यू डीकंपोजिशन (SVD)
SVD एक शक्तिशाली तकनीक है जिसका उपयोग डेटा को कम करने और शोर को हटाने के लिए किया जाता है। यह इमेज कम्प्रेशन, सिफारिश प्रणाली और प्राकृतिक भाषा प्रसंस्करण जैसे अनुप्रयोगों में व्यापक रूप से उपयोग किया जाता है।
कैलकुलस: डीप लर्निंग का इंजन
कैलकुलस डीप लर्निंग एल्गोरिदम के प्रशिक्षण के लिए आवश्यक है। यह हमें यह समझने में मदद करता है कि मॉडल के पैरामीटर को कैसे समायोजित किया जाए ताकि वे बेहतर प्रदर्शन करें। विशेष रूप से, बैकप्रोपेगेशन एल्गोरिथ्म, जो डीप लर्निंग का आधार है, कैलकुलस के डेरिवेटिव और ग्रेडिएंट पर निर्भर करता है।
डेरिवेटिव और ग्रेडिएंट
डेरिवेटिव एक फ़ंक्शन के परिवर्तन की दर को मापते हैं, जबकि ग्रेडिएंट बहुआयामी फ़ंक्शन के सबसे तेज़ वृद्धि की दिशा को इंगित करता है। डीप लर्निंग में, हम ग्रेडिएंट का उपयोग लॉस फ़ंक्शन को कम करने के लिए करते हैं, जो मॉडल के प्रदर्शन को मापता है।
चेन रूल
चेन रूल कैलकुलस का एक महत्वपूर्ण नियम है जो हमें जटिल कार्यों के डेरिवेटिव की गणना करने में मदद करता है। यह बैकप्रोपेगेशन एल्गोरिथ्म में आवश्यक है, जो मॉडल के त्रुटियों को परतों के माध्यम से वापस फैलाता है और पैरामीटर को अपडेट करता है।
ऑप्टिमाइजेशन एल्गोरिदम
कैलकुलस ऑप्टिमाइजेशन एल्गोरिदम के लिए आधार प्रदान करता है, जैसे कि ग्रेडिएंट डिसेंट, जो मॉडल के पैरामीटर को समायोजित करने के लिए उपयोग किए जाते हैं ताकि लॉस फ़ंक्शन को कम किया जा सके।
प्रायिकता और सांख्यिकी: अनिश्चितता से निपटना
प्रायिकता और सांख्यिकी डीप लर्निंग में अनिश्चितता से निपटने के लिए आवश्यक हैं। डेटा में शोर और अनिश्चितता होती है, और प्रायिकता हमें इन अनिश्चितताओं को मॉडल करने और उनसे निपटने में मदद करती है।
प्रायिकता वितरण
प्रायिकता वितरण डेटा के विभिन्न मूल्यों की संभावनाओं का वर्णन करते हैं। डीप लर्निंग में, हम प्रायिकता वितरण का उपयोग मॉडल के आउटपुट को मॉडल करने और अनिश्चितता को मापने के लिए करते हैं।
सांख्यिकीय अनुमान
सांख्यिकीय अनुमान हमें डेटा से निष्कर्ष निकालने और भविष्यवाणियां करने में मदद करता है। हम सांख्यिकीय अनुमान का उपयोग मॉडल के प्रदर्शन का आकलन करने और सामान्यीकरण त्रुटि का अनुमान लगाने के लिए करते हैं।
बायेसियन नेटवर्क

बायेसियन नेटवर्क प्रायिकता ग्राफिकल मॉडल हैं जो हमें जटिल प्रणालियों में अनिश्चितता को मॉडल करने में मदद करते हैं। इनका उपयोग प्राकृतिक भाषा प्रसंस्करण, चिकित्सा निदान और जोखिम मूल्यांकन जैसे अनुप्रयोगों में किया जाता है।
जानकारी सिद्धांत: डेटा को समझना
जानकारी सिद्धांत हमें डेटा में जानकारी की मात्रा को मापने और संपीड़ित करने में मदद करता है। यह डीप लर्निंग में फीचर चयन, डेटा संपीड़न और मॉडल मूल्यांकन जैसे कार्यों के लिए उपयोगी है।
एंट्रॉपी
एंट्रॉपी अनिश्चितता या आश्चर्य की मात्रा को मापता है। एक उच्च एंट्रॉपी इंगित करता है कि डेटा अधिक अप्रत्याशित है, जबकि एक कम एंट्रॉपी इंगित करता है कि डेटा अधिक पूर्वानुमानित है।
सूचना लाभ
सूचना लाभ मापता है कि एक चर के बारे में जानकारी होने से दूसरे चर के बारे में अनिश्चितता कितनी कम हो जाती है। इसका उपयोग फीचर चयन में प्रासंगिक सुविधाओं की पहचान करने के लिए किया जाता है।
क्रॉस एंट्रॉपी
क्रॉस एंट्रॉपी दो प्रायिकता वितरण के बीच अंतर को मापता है। डीप लर्निंग में, हम क्रॉस एंट्रॉपी का उपयोग लॉस फ़ंक्शन के रूप में करते हैं, जो मॉडल के अनुमानित वितरण और वास्तविक वितरण के बीच अंतर को मापता है।
डीप लर्निंग एल्गोरिदम में गणित का अनुप्रयोग
विभिन्न डीप लर्निंग एल्गोरिदम विभिन्न गणितीय अवधारणाओं का उपयोग करते हैं। यहाँ कुछ उदाहरण दिए गए हैं:* कनवल्शनल न्यूरल नेटवर्क (CNN): लीनियर अलजेब्रा (मैट्रिक्स गुणन), कैलकुलस (डेरिवेटिव), और प्रायिकता (सक्रियण कार्य)
* आवर्तक तंत्रिका नेटवर्क (RNN): कैलकुलस (चेन रूल), लीनियर अलजेब्रा (मैट्रिक्स संचालन), और प्रायिकता (भाषा मॉडलिंग)
* जनरेटिव एडवर्सरियल नेटवर्क (GAN): कैलकुलस (ऑप्टिमाइजेशन), प्रायिकता (उत्पन्न मॉडल), और जानकारी सिद्धांत (अपसरण)
| गणितीय अवधारणा | डीप लर्निंग में अनुप्रयोग |
|---|---|
| रेखीय बीजगणित | डेटा प्रतिनिधित्व, मैट्रिक्स संचालन |
| कैलकुलस | बैकप्रोपेगेशन, ऑप्टिमाइजेशन |
| प्रायिकता और सांख्यिकी | अनिश्चितता मॉडलिंग, सांख्यिकीय अनुमान |
| जानकारी सिद्धांत | फीचर चयन, डेटा संपीड़न |
डीप लर्निंग के लिए गणित कैसे सीखें
यदि आप डीप लर्निंग के लिए गणित सीखना चाहते हैं, तो यहां कुछ सुझाव दिए गए हैं:* बुनियादी बातों से शुरुआत करें: सुनिश्चित करें कि आपके पास लीनियर अलजेब्रा, कैलकुलस और प्रायिकता की ठोस समझ है।
* ऑनलाइन पाठ्यक्रम लें: कई उत्कृष्ट ऑनलाइन पाठ्यक्रम उपलब्ध हैं जो डीप लर्निंग के लिए गणित सिखाते हैं।
* किताबें पढ़ें: कई उत्कृष्ट पुस्तकें हैं जो डीप लर्निंग के लिए गणित को कवर करती हैं।
* अभ्यास करें: गणित सीखने का सबसे अच्छा तरीका है अभ्यास करना। समस्याओं को हल करें और कोड लिखें।
* समुदाय में शामिल हों: अन्य लोगों से जुड़ें जो डीप लर्निंग के लिए गणित सीख रहे हैं। प्रश्न पूछें और अनुभव साझा करें।डीप लर्निंग के गणितीय आधार को समझने के लिए यह एक ज़रूरी यात्रा थी। उम्मीद है, अब आप समझ गए होंगे कि कैसे लीनियर अलजेब्रा, कैलकुलस, प्रायिकता और सूचना सिद्धांत डीप लर्निंग एल्गोरिदम को शक्ति प्रदान करते हैं।
लेख को समाप्त करते हुए
यह तो बस शुरुआत है! डीप लर्निंग में गणित का उपयोग और भी गहरा और विविध है। जैसे-जैसे आप इस क्षेत्र में आगे बढ़ेंगे, आप गणित के नए और रोमांचक अनुप्रयोगों की खोज करेंगे।
याद रखें, गणित केवल एक उपकरण नहीं है, बल्कि डीप लर्निंग की भाषा है। इसे सीखकर, आप डीप लर्निंग की दुनिया के दरवाजे खोल रहे हैं।
तो, गणित सीखना जारी रखें, प्रयोग करते रहें, और डीप लर्निंग की अद्भुत दुनिया का पता लगाते रहें!
शुभकामनाएं!
जानने योग्य उपयोगी जानकारी
1. ऑनलाइन डीप लर्निंग समुदाय से जुड़ें और अनुभवी लोगों से मार्गदर्शन लें।
2. डीप लर्निंग से संबंधित नवीनतम रिसर्च पेपर और ब्लॉग पोस्ट पढ़ें।
3. अपने स्वयं के डीप लर्निंग प्रोजेक्ट्स बनाएं और उन्हें वास्तविक दुनिया के डेटा पर लागू करें।
4. TensorFlow और PyTorch जैसे लोकप्रिय डीप लर्निंग लाइब्रेरी के साथ प्रयोग करें।
5. डीप लर्निंग सम्मेलनों और कार्यशालाओं में भाग लें।
महत्वपूर्ण बातों का सारांश
डीप लर्निंग गणित पर आधारित है, जिसमें लीनियर अलजेब्रा, कैलकुलस, प्रायिकता और सूचना सिद्धांत शामिल हैं।
लीनियर अलजेब्रा डेटा को मैट्रिक्स और वेक्टर के रूप में प्रस्तुत करने में मदद करता है।
कैलकुलस डीप लर्निंग एल्गोरिदम के प्रशिक्षण के लिए आवश्यक है।
प्रायिकता और सांख्यिकी डीप लर्निंग में अनिश्चितता से निपटने के लिए आवश्यक हैं।
जानकारी सिद्धांत हमें डेटा में जानकारी की मात्रा को मापने और संपीड़ित करने में मदद करता है।
अक्सर पूछे जाने वाले प्रश्न (FAQ) 📖
प्र: डीप लर्निंग में गणित का क्या महत्व है?
उ: डीप लर्निंग एल्गोरिदम गणितीय समीकरणों पर आधारित होते हैं, जो डेटा से सीखते हैं और भविष्यवाणियां करते हैं। कैलकुलस, लीनियर अलजेब्रा और प्रायिकता जैसी गणितीय अवधारणाएं ही डीप लर्निंग को इतना शक्तिशाली बनाती हैं। गणित के बिना, डीप लर्निंग काम नहीं कर सकता।
प्र: GPT जैसे मॉडल किस गणितीय नींव पर टिके हुए हैं?
उ: GPT जैसे मॉडल भी गहरी गणितीय नींव पर ही टिके हुए हैं। ये मॉडल जटिल सांख्यिकीय मॉडल का उपयोग करते हैं जो बड़ी मात्रा में डेटा से सीखते हैं। इन मॉडलों को प्रशिक्षित करने के लिए कैलकुलस और लीनियर अलजेब्रा जैसी गणितीय अवधारणाओं का गहन उपयोग किया जाता है।
प्र: भविष्य में डीप लर्निंग और गणित का संयोजन क्या कर सकता है?
उ: भविष्य में, डीप लर्निंग और गणित का संयोजन और भी अद्भुत चीजें कर सकता है। हम बेहतर चिकित्सा निदान, अधिक सटीक मौसम पूर्वानुमान, और नई वैज्ञानिक खोजों की उम्मीद कर सकते हैं। गणित और डीप लर्निंग मिलकर हमारे जीवन को कई तरह से बेहतर बना सकते हैं।
📚 संदर्भ
Wikipedia Encyclopedia
구글 검색 결과
구글 검색 결과
구글 검색 결과
구글 검색 결과
구글 검색 결과






